Jeanne Mason is a Trinidadian resident who has promoted reading, writing and drama in Trinidad since her arrival in 2002. As a writer and editor, she started a writers group at NALIS from which several members went on to publish their works. She is the co-editor the anthology Trinidad Noir (Akashic, 2008) and co-editor of the collection Salt & Pines (The History Press, 2010). She is the author of the 3-volume secondary series Caribbean Theatre Arts and Drama (Royards 2012-2014). Currently she is working on a Visual and Performing Arts series for Royards.
